Q: Is 213,913,312 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 213,913,312 is not a prime number.

Why is 213,913,312 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 213913312 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 17 32 34 67 68 134 136 268 272 536 544 1,072 1,139 2,144 2,278 4,556 5,869 9,112 11,738 18,224 23,476 36,448 46,952 93,904 99,773 187,808 199,546 393,223 399,092 786,446 798,184 1,572,892 1,596,368 3,145,784 3,192,736 6,291,568 6,684,791 12,583,136 13,369,582 26,739,164 53,478,328 106,956,656 and 213,913,312, with no remainder.

Since 213,913,312 cannot be divided by just 1 and 213,913,312, it is not a prime number.
